How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Log Cabin?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Log Cabin Studio Apartments | $835 | $790 | $1,128 |
| Log Cabin 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,270 | $377 | $1,899 |
| Log Cabin 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,325 | $457 | $2,703 |
| Log Cabin 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,458 | $532 | $2,481 |
| Log Cabin 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,357 | $591 | $5,215 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Log Cabin
How much are Studio apartments in Log Cabin?
There are currently 3 Studio Apartments in Log Cabin with rent ranges from $790 to $1,128 with an average price of $835.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Log Cabin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Log Cabin ranges from $377 to $1,899 with an average monthly rent of $1,270.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Log Cabin c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Log Cabin range from $457 to $2,703.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,325.
How expensive are Log Cabin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 31 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Log Cabin on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$532 to $2,481 - averaging $1,458 for the location.
